Abstract

The utility model discloses a hand-held and movable root canal therapy dental pulp hole detection photographing and video recording system, which is an innovative technology for simply detecting dental pulp holes, the detection method is that aiming at teeth to be treated by root canal therapy, after the tooth is drilled and expanded, a group of detecting heads consisting of a light source and a super-Wei type photographic lens module are extended into the tooth chamber for direct observation, photographing and video recording, so as to obtain the detailed position, quantity, direction and other data of the dental pulp holes, the photographic probe is connected with an extension hose on a small-sized control platform, and the observed image can be clearly displayed on an external or built-in color touch display screen through the control platform, so that the system can be conveniently held and moved during treatment, so as to determine the quantity, position, size, direction and the like of the dental pulp holes in the teeth of a patient, and the root canal therapy of the teeth such as cleaning, disinfection and filling are more accurate and effective, greatly improving the curative effect of root canal treatment.

Background
The root canal therapy mainly aims to solve pulpitis and periapical periodontitis and is based on the premise of keeping the original teeth, the process of the root canal therapy is complex and fine, firstly, carious tissues of a tooth body are ground and then a tooth crown is drilled, tooth pulp holes are exposed, infected tooth pulp is extracted by a dental needle (commonly called nerve extraction), the length of a root canal is measured, the shape of the root canal is modified, namely, the fine and thin root canal is slowly enlarged by a root canal file, then, sterile water is used for flushing to remove tissue debris and bacteria residues on the root canal, after the tooth canal is enlarged to a clean ground step, the root canal is sealed with disinfection drugs, the original drugs are taken out after a period of time, the root canal is sealed by permanent materials, and finally, the shape of the teeth is repaired. Most of the traditional root canal treatment procedures only depend on the experience and hand feeling of doctors, dental pulp tissues and related nerves are destroyed and crushed by treatment instruments on hands, except for cleaning the dental pulp tissues, the nerve activity destruction is killed, then the dental braces are sealed and filled or sleeved, but in the treatment process of only depending on the experience and hand feeling, most of the procedures are carried out by only using the dental pulp to lean against the teeth and irradiating the exposed dental pulp holes on the mirror surface of a dental endoscope for detection, however, because the mirror surface of the dental endoscope is too small, the conditions in the dental cavities can not be clearly detected, the number, the positions, the sizes and the directions of the dental pulp holes can not be determined, so that the treatment is not reliable enough, or the dental pulp holes hidden at the corners of the dental cavities can be omitted, the dental pulp tissues are not clean, or the nerve activity is not completely destroyed, it is easy to cause re-inflammation of the apex of the tooth, such chronic inflammation is usually ignored, but bacteria are already hidden in the nerve root, and if not cleaned completely, the hidden crisis, such as periodontal disease and the like, is left, which causes even worse results.
In recent years, although a high-magnification medical microscope is used to partially enlarge the root canal by 12-25 times and match with strong light to improve the defects of the traditional root canal therapy, the micro root canal therapy instrument has large volume, is not easy to install and operate, is inconvenient to use, has one or two million new taiwan coins for each machine, is difficult to bear high cost and subsequent expensive maintenance cost for general dental clinics, and therefore, the micro root canal therapy instrument does not meet economic benefits in practical application and cannot be popularized.

Detailed Description
Referring to fig. 1, the detecting method of the portable and mobile endodontic hole detecting, photographing and video recording system of the present invention is mainly directed to a tooth to be endodontic treated S1, a set of detecting head S2 with a light source S21 and a lens module 22 is directly inserted into the tooth cavity of the tooth opening for observation to obtain the complete image data of the pulp hole inside the tooth cavity, the detector head S2 is connected to an extension tube S3, so that the acquired image can be completely displayed on an external or internal color touch display screen S5 by the operation of the controller S4, so that the images of the number, position and size of the pulp holes can be clearly displayed before the treatment in the process of the root canal treatment, the display screen can clearly see the root canal treatment, so that the medical content and procedure can be correctly judged during the root canal treatment, and the optimal root canal treatment effect can be achieved.
Referring to fig. 2 and 3, the specific device of the portable and portable endodontic detection, photographing and recording system of the present invention mainly comprises a body 10, a handle 20, a detecting unit 30, the front of the main body 10 has a display screen 11, the bottom of the main body 10 has a handle 20, the main body 10 has a controller 12, the handle 20 is provided with a control button 21, the back of the main body 10 is connected with the detection unit 30 and is pivoted with the main body 10 through a soft extension pipe 31, a mobile phone seat 32 is arranged at the tail end of the extension pipe 31, the mobile phone holder 32 is pivoted with a detecting body 33, a detecting head 331 with a light source and a lens module arranged therein is arranged at the bottom of the tail end of the detecting body 33, the shape of the whole combined structure is similar to that of a hand-held drilling mobile phone tool frequently used by dentists, to facilitate use of dentist inertia, wherein the diameter of sensing head 331 is less than 2.3 mm. By using the device, a medical staff can hold the mobile phone seat 32 of the detection unit 30 with one hand, directly observe the tooth to be treated by the root canal with the detection head 331 by using the detection body 33, directly extend the detection body 33 into the tooth cavity from the opening on the tooth to take a picture or photograph so as to obtain an internal image containing data such as the number, position and size of the tooth pulp holes, and clearly display the observed image on the display screen 11 of the external body 10 through the extension pipe 31, so that when the root canal treatment is carried out, the medical staff can effectively carry out treatment of expanding the tooth root, clearing the root canal, disinfecting, filling and other teeth according to the complete and correct data, thereby overcoming the defect that the prior art can only depend on experience or blindness, and achieving the purpose of effective healing. The detecting head 331 of the detecting unit 30 can be easily fastened and detached, and can be cleaned and sterilized after one-time treatment.
